If you have a long vacation
planned,
empty the Refrigerator
and turn it off.
Wipe excess moisturefrom the insideand leavethe doors open to keep odor and mold from developing.

Children
can get trapped
inside Refrigerators.
Before you throw away your old Refrigerator or Freezer, make sure that you;
• Take off the doors
o Leavealtshelvesin places so that childrenmay not easilyclimb insideand shut the door while they are
inside
